The increasing representation of blended families in modern cinema can be attributed to several factors. Firstly, the growing diversity of family structures in real life has led to a greater demand for authentic and relatable storytelling. Filmmakers are responding to this demand by creating more nuanced and realistic portrayals of family life, which often involve complex relationships and blended family dynamics.
The concept of blended families, also known as stepfamilies, has become increasingly prevalent in modern society. This phenomenon has not gone unnoticed in the film industry, where a growing number of movies are tackling the complexities of blended family dynamics.
